Question : Which one of the following is not an excretory organ?

Option 1: Kidneys

Option 2: Liver

Option 3: Lungs

Option 4: Spleen

Team Careers360 25th Jan, 2024

Correct Answer: Spleen


Solution : The correct option is Spleen.

The spleen does not function as an excretory organ. While the kidney, lungs and liver play roles in excretion or waste disposal, the spleen is largely engaged in immune system processes, blood filtering and red blood cell storage.

Question : The famous Vishnu Temple at Angkor Wat in Cambodia was built by

Option 1: Shrutakarma

Option 2: Suryavarman II

Option 3: Indravarman

Option 4: Aniruddha

Team Careers360 13th Jan, 2024

Correct Answer: Suryavarman II


Solution : The correct answer is Suryavarman II.

Question : Which of the following movements saw the biggest peasant guerilla war on the eve of independence ?

Option 1: Noakhali Movement

Option 2: Tebhaga Movement

Option 3: Punnapra Vayalar Movement

Option 4: Telangana Movement

Team Careers360 12th Jan, 2024

Correct Answer: Telangana Movement


Solution : The Correct Answer is Telangana Movement

The Telangana movement, which took place from 1948 to 1951, was an armed uprising of peasants led by the Communist Party of India against oppressive landlordism that was supported by the tyrannical rule of the Nizam of Hyderabad.

Question : Directions: Which of the following numbers will replace the question mark (?) in the given series?
245, 212, ?, 146, 113, 80

Option 1: 176

Option 2: 179

Option 3: 178

Option 4: 180

Team Careers360 5th Jan, 2024

Correct Answer: 179


Solution : Given:
245, 212, ?, 146, 113, 80

Subtract 33 from each term to get the next term in the series.
245 – 33 = 212; 212 – 33 = 179; 179 – 33 = 146; 146 – 33 = 113; 113 – 33 = 80
